kṛṣṇa-mantre - in the holy mantra Hare Kṛṣṇa; karÄila - caused to perform; dui - two; puraÅ›caraṇa - religious ceremonies; acirÄt - without delay; pÄibÄre - to get; caitanya-caraṇa - the shelter of the lotus feet of ÅšrÄ« Caitanya MahÄprabhu.
A puraÅ›caraṇa is a ritualistic ceremony performed under the guidance of an expert spiritual master or a brÄhmaṇa. It is performed for the fulfillment of certain desires. One rises early in the morning, chants the Hare Kṛṣṇa mantra, performs arcana by the Ärati ceremony and worships the Deities. These activities are described in Madhya-lÄ«lÄ, fifteenth chapter, verse 108.
